PURPOSE:To avoid loosening by a method wherein a superconductive coil is formed while being applied a prestress equivalent to the electromagnetic force to the radial direction and the axial direction of the coil and hardened by resin. CONSTITUTION:A superconductor 21 is wound in a coil shape on a protective cylinder 14 put on the circumference of a cylinder 13 made of elastic material and a cylindrical spacer 22 one side of which is a slope is pressed against the end surface of the winding start and the winding end of the coil. A covering cylinder 23 is put on the coil and epoxy resin or the like is poured from a resin inlet 23a. Then pressurized oil is injected from oil inlets 11a, 19a so that the radial direction force equivalent to the electromagnetic force and the axial direction force equivalent to the electromagnetic force are applied to the coil through the cylinder 13 and through a movable cylinder 16 and the spacer 22 respectively. Under this condition, the resin is heated and cured. With this constitution, loosening of the superconductor caused by the electromagnetic force produced by the coil excitation during operation is avoided and the safety and the reliability are improved. |
